(poems go here) What color did they bleed, oh foolish one?
Your hands are stained it.
What color did they scream?
Your soul is tainted with it.
What color did they weep?
Your cheeks are seared with it.
What color did they fear?
Your cage is built with it.
What color did they hate?
Your noose is tied with it.
What color did they love?
Your corpse is shrouded with it.
Grieve with me, oh selfish one.
For there will always be those like us.
